2 | Nintendo Wii Nunchuk controller | |
3 | ------------------------------------------------------------------------------- | |
4 | ||
5 | This is a collection of example captures of I2C traffic from/to a Nintendo | |
6 | Wii Nunchuk game controller. | |
7 | ||
8 | A Dangerous Prototypes Buspirate (v4) was used as I2C master to talk to the | |
9 | Nunchuk controller. | |
10 | ||

18 | Logic analyzer setup | |
19 | -------------------- | |
20 | ||
21 | The logic analyzer used was a Saleae Logic (at 1MHz): | |
22 | ||
23 | Probe I2C pin | |
24 | ------------------- | |
25 | 3 (red) SCL | |
26 | 7 (blue) SDA | |
27 | ||
28 | ||
29 | Buspirate setup | |
30 | --------------- | |
31 | ||
32 | Connections: | |
33 | ||
34 | Buspirate Nunchuk I2C breakout adapter | |
35 | ---------------------------------------- | |
36 | GND - (GND) | |
37 | +3.3 + (VCC) | |
38 | MOSI d (SDA) | |
39 | CLK c (SCL) | |
40 | ||
41 | The basic setup after connecting to the Buspirate on /dev/ttyACM0 | |
42 | (115200, 8n1) via minicom was: | |
43 | ||
44 | HiZ>m (mode) | |
45 | (1)>4 (I2C) | |
46 | (1)>2 (I2C mode: hardware) | |
47 | (1)>1 (speed: 100kHz) | |
48 | I2C>W (enable Buspirate power supplies) | |
49 | ||
50 | See below for further per-file I2C commands used. | |
51 | ||
52 | ||
53 | sigrok | |
54 | ------ | |
55 | ||
56 | The sigrok command line used was: | |
57 | ||
58 | sigrok-cli -d fx2lafw:samplerate=1mhz --time <ms> \ | |
59 | -p '3=SCL,7=SDA' -o <filename> | |
60 | ||
61 | The <ms> and <filename> parameters vary depending on the file. | |
62 | ||

64 | wii_nunchuk_init.sr | |
65 | ------------------- | |
66 | ||
67 | I2C>[0xa4 0x40 0x00] | |
68 | I2C START BIT | |
69 | WRITE: 0xA4 ACK | |
70 | WRITE: 0x40 ACK | |
71 | WRITE: 0x00 ACK | |
72 | I2C STOP BIT | |
73 | ||
74 | ||
75 | wii_nunchuk_set_reg.sr | |
76 | ---------------------- | |
77 | ||
78 | I2C>[0xa4 0x00] | |
79 | I2C START BIT | |
80 | WRITE: 0xA4 ACK | |
81 | WRITE: 0x00 ACK | |
82 | I2C STOP BIT | |
83 | ||
84 | ||
85 | wii_nunchuk_data_idle.sr | |
86 | ------------------------ | |
87 | ||
88 | No buttons were pressed, the analog stick was not moved. | |
89 | ||
90 | I2C>[0xa5 r:6] | |
91 | I2C START BIT | |
92 | WRITE: 0xA5 ACK | |
93 | READ: 0x74 ACK 0x7F ACK 0x7B ACK 0x20 ACK 0x7D ACK 0xC7 | |
94 | NACK | |
95 | ||
96 | ||
97 | wii_nunchuk_data_left.sr | |
98 | ------------------------ | |
99 | ||
100 | No buttons were pressed, the analog stick was moved to the left. | |
101 | ||
102 | I2C>[0xa5 r:6] | |
103 | I2C START BIT | |
104 | WRITE: 0xA5 ACK | |
105 | READ: 0x12 ACK 0x7C ACK 0x48 ACK 0x2C ACK 0x97 ACK 0x2F | |
106 | NACK | |
107 | I2C STOP BIT | |
